Los Angeles is home to diverse food trends, but few have made as charming an entrance as Cafe Knotted, the famed South Korean dessert café that opened its first U.S. location in early 2025. Located inside the upscale Westfield Century City, this vibrant café has quickly become a local favorite, known for its colorful pastries, whipped-matcha drinks, and whimsical atmosphere.
Cafe Knotted is celebrated for its playful, pastel branding and joyful take on classic treats. Its signature doughnuts come in unique flavors such as strawberry milk, kaya butter, Earl Grey, and Korean-style custard, often filled and topped with seasonal ingredients. Complementing the sweets are artisanal beverages like ube lattes, brown sugar cold brew, and “berry nachos”—a dish blending fresh fruit, cream, and mochi on sweet chips. Everything is presented with visual flair, designed to be both delicious and photogenic.
The café’s design reflects the same cheerful aesthetic seen in its flagship stores across Seoul. Inside, guests are greeted with neon signage, cartoon mascots, and a bright, airy vibe that makes it more than just a dessert stop—it’s an experience. It’s especially popular with fans of Korean pop culture and Gen Z foodies looking for that perfect café moment to share online.
Cafe Knotted represents a broader wave of South Korean culinary culture gaining ground in Los Angeles, joining other favorites in K-Town and beyond.
